As an aesthetic plastic surgeon in Boston, I can provide insight into the healing time for Biocorneum, a popular scar management product. Biocorneum is a medical-grade silicone gel that is designed to improve the appearance of scars, including those resulting from surgical procedures, burns, or other skin injuries.
The healing time for Biocorneum can vary depending on several factors, but generally, patients can expect to see improvements in the appearance of their scars within a few weeks to a few months of consistent use. Here's a more detailed overview of the typical healing timeline:
Initial Application: Patients can typically begin using Biocorneum as soon as the initial wound has closed and sutures or staples have been removed. This is usually about 2-3 weeks after the initial surgery or injury. During this time, the scar is still in the early stages of healing, and Biocorneum can help to soften and flatten the scar tissue.
First 2-4 Weeks: During the first few weeks of using Biocorneum, patients may notice that the scar begins to flatten and become less raised. The silicone gel helps to hydrate the scar tissue and reduce inflammation, which can improve the overall appearance of the scar.
2-3 Months: As the scar continues to mature, patients may notice further improvements in the color, texture, and overall appearance of the scar. Biocorneum can help to reduce redness, itchiness, and discomfort associated with the healing process.
3-6 Months: By the 3-6 month mark, patients may see significant improvements in the appearance of their scars. The scar should become flatter, smoother, and less noticeable. However, it's important to note that the full effects of Biocorneum may not be visible until 6-12 months after the initial application.
Ongoing Use: To maintain the benefits of Biocorneum, patients should continue to use the product as directed, typically for several months or even years after the initial injury or surgery. Consistent use is key to achieving the best possible results.
It's important to note that the healing time for Biocorneum can vary from patient to patient, depending on factors such as the size and location of the scar, the severity of the injury, and the individual's skin type and healing response. Patients should follow the instructions provided by their healthcare provider and be patient, as the full benefits of Biocorneum may take several months to become fully evident.
